Hello,

Looking for advice on LPS and soft corals.
I've had multiple die on me. I have a 90g tank.
Chalice - bleached out
Torch - bleached
Zoas - just like disappeared slowly
Alveoporas - 2 bleached

What is still in the tank: 1 torch, multiple hammers, a few zoas, 2 candy cane's, gsp, mushroom, 1 alveopora

I know my phosphate and nitrate are issues. I always struggled with them. I don't want to use chemicals. I use phosguard but I felt like it was causing to much fluctuation so I Haven't been doing anything. My phosphate level is usually around 0.70. Nitrates between 20-30.
Mg - 1400
Ca - 400
Kh - 8.9-9
Sg 1.025-1.026
Ph - fluctuates usually between 7.8-8

My lights are cheap. Just some ones of amazon. Maybe that's the culprit?

I'm going to a frag swap tmrw and don't want to get frags that will die on me. Any recommendations given my issues with phosphate/nitrate?

I feel like my corals also take forever to grow. I used to feed but stopped with the phosphate issue.

Thank you!

I see coralline which is a good sign of tank health. Your numbers are not bad just slightly elevated phosphate so that leaves light and flow. Euphyllia are always difficult. You need to par check your tank. Pics look like light might be low intensity.
